CSAFE seeks input from the forensic science community about their learning preferences.

 

The Center for Statistics and Applications in Forensic Evidence (CSAFE) invites forensic science practitioners to participate in a survey on how they prefer to learn about new technologies, research studies and statistics.

CSAFE’s mission is to provide the forensic science community with cutting-edge education and thought leadership in forensic statistics. The survey responses will provide insight into the community’s learning needs and guide future educational programming. That includes diversifying learning opportunities to best suit the needs and desires of forensic practitioners.

The survey takes approximately five minutes to complete and will be open until Sept. 30, 2021. All survey responses are anonymous.
